S&P 500   2,626.65 (+3.35%)
DOW   22,327.48 (+3.19%)
QQQ   192.04 (+3.64%)
AAPL   254.81 (+2.85%)
FB   165.95 (+5.84%)
MSFT   160.23 (+7.03%)
GOOGL   1,146.31 (+3.25%)
AMZN   1,963.95 (+3.36%)
CGC   14.46 (-0.89%)
NVDA   265.59 (+5.09%)
BABA   191.27 (+1.42%)
MU   44.52 (+2.39%)
GE   7.89 (+3.54%)
TSLA   502.13 (-2.38%)
AMD   47.86 (+2.75%)
T   30.23 (+1.31%)
ACB   0.89 (-13.63%)
F   5.03 (-2.14%)
NFLX   370.96 (+3.88%)
BAC   22.04 (+2.04%)
GILD   75.93 (+4.23%)
DIS   99.80 (+3.53%)
S&P 500   2,626.65 (+3.35%)
DOW   22,327.48 (+3.19%)
QQQ   192.04 (+3.64%)
AAPL   254.81 (+2.85%)
FB   165.95 (+5.84%)
MSFT   160.23 (+7.03%)
GOOGL   1,146.31 (+3.25%)
AMZN   1,963.95 (+3.36%)
CGC   14.46 (-0.89%)
NVDA   265.59 (+5.09%)
BABA   191.27 (+1.42%)
MU   44.52 (+2.39%)
GE   7.89 (+3.54%)
TSLA   502.13 (-2.38%)
AMD   47.86 (+2.75%)
T   30.23 (+1.31%)
ACB   0.89 (-13.63%)
F   5.03 (-2.14%)
NFLX   370.96 (+3.88%)
BAC   22.04 (+2.04%)
GILD   75.93 (+4.23%)
DIS   99.80 (+3.53%)
S&P 500   2,626.65 (+3.35%)
DOW   22,327.48 (+3.19%)
QQQ   192.04 (+3.64%)
AAPL   254.81 (+2.85%)
FB   165.95 (+5.84%)
MSFT   160.23 (+7.03%)
GOOGL   1,146.31 (+3.25%)
AMZN   1,963.95 (+3.36%)
CGC   14.46 (-0.89%)
NVDA   265.59 (+5.09%)
BABA   191.27 (+1.42%)
MU   44.52 (+2.39%)
GE   7.89 (+3.54%)
TSLA   502.13 (-2.38%)
AMD   47.86 (+2.75%)
T   30.23 (+1.31%)
ACB   0.89 (-13.63%)
F   5.03 (-2.14%)
NFLX   370.96 (+3.88%)
BAC   22.04 (+2.04%)
GILD   75.93 (+4.23%)
DIS   99.80 (+3.53%)
S&P 500   2,626.65 (+3.35%)
DOW   22,327.48 (+3.19%)
QQQ   192.04 (+3.64%)
AAPL   254.81 (+2.85%)
FB   165.95 (+5.84%)
MSFT   160.23 (+7.03%)
GOOGL   1,146.31 (+3.25%)
AMZN   1,963.95 (+3.36%)
CGC   14.46 (-0.89%)
NVDA   265.59 (+5.09%)
BABA   191.27 (+1.42%)
MU   44.52 (+2.39%)
GE   7.89 (+3.54%)
TSLA   502.13 (-2.38%)
AMD   47.86 (+2.75%)
T   30.23 (+1.31%)
ACB   0.89 (-13.63%)
F   5.03 (-2.14%)
NFLX   370.96 (+3.88%)
BAC   22.04 (+2.04%)
GILD   75.93 (+4.23%)
DIS   99.80 (+3.53%)
Log in

Compare Stocks

Enter up to five stock symbols separated by a comma or space (ex. BAC,WFC,JPM,LON:BARC).
Date Range: 

 CitigroupWells Fargo & CoU.S. BancorpPNC Financial Services GroupIndustrial & Cmrcl Bnk f China
SymbolNYSE:CNYSE:WFCNYSE:USBNYSE:PNCOTCMKTS:IDCBY
Price Information
Current Price$44.08$29.92$35.85$100.97$13.01
52 Week RangeBuyHoldHoldHoldN/A
Analyst Ratings
Consensus RecommendationBuyHoldHoldHoldN/A
Consensus Price Target$87.29$46.98$54.89$143.80N/A
% Upside from Price Target98.03% upside57.01% upside53.12% upside42.42% upsideN/A
Trade Information
Market Cap$91.90 billion$123.83 billion$54.42 billion$42.93 billion$231.84 billion
Beta1.761.141.141.190.98
Average Volume35,517,72051,899,24815,851,1924,224,126154,159
Sales & Book Value
Annual Revenue$103.45 billion$103.92 billion$27.33 billion$21.62 billion$159.15 billion
Price / Sales0.891.182.002.001.46
Cashflow$10.28 per share$6.55 per share$4.94 per share$15.14 per share$10.66 per share
Price / Cash4.294.577.256.671.22
Book Value$80.60 per share$39.35 per share$29.77 per share$110.82 per share$81.64 per share
Price / Book0.550.761.200.910.16
Profitability
Net Income$19.40 billion$19.55 billion$6.91 billion$5.37 billion$44.98 billion
EPS$7.58$4.38$4.34$11.39N/A
Trailing P/E Ratio5.487.448.668.865.22
Forward P/E Ratio4.767.198.208.55
P/E Growth$0.51$0.76$1.45$1.16N/A
Net Margins18.75%18.81%25.30%24.83%25.86%
Return on Equity (ROE)10.32%12.11%15.23%10.91%12.43%
Return on Assets (ROA)0.93%1.09%1.48%1.33%1.05%
Dividend
Annual Payout$2.04$2.04$1.68$4.60$0.61
Dividend Yield4.63%6.82%4.69%4.56%4.69%
Three-Year Dividend Growth28.56%9.83%13.14%20.95%N/A
Payout Ratio26.91%46.58%38.71%40.39%N/A
Years of Consecutive Dividend Growth5 Years8 Years9 Years9 YearsN/A
Debt
Debt-to-Equity Ratio1.41%1.37%0.86%1.04%1.09%
Current Ratio1.00%0.87%0.83%0.89%0.91%
Quick Ratio1.00%0.85%0.82%0.88%0.91%
Ownership Information
Institutional Ownership Percentage79.83%76.50%76.41%82.60%0.01%
Insider Ownership Percentage0.07%0.09%0.23%0.30%N/A
Miscellaneous
Employees200,000260,00069,65151,918449,296
Shares Outstanding2.10 billion4.09 billion1.52 billion428.73 million17.82 billion
Next Earnings Date4/15/2020 (Confirmed)4/14/2020 (Confirmed)4/15/2020 (Confirmed)4/15/2020 (Confirmed)N/A
OptionableOptionableOptionableOptionableOptionableNot Optionable

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.

Yahoo Gemini Pixel